Kids prove dab hands

MT Dandenong Primary School held its annual arts show recently, displaying a year’s worth of students’ work for their parents and friends.
The students did artworks in various media, including paintings and drawings, with the help of local artists Paula Ewington, Joy Serwylo, Marta Salamon, Karen Scott and Ches Mills. More than 200 works were on display.
Principal Mike Leonard said the show was a great way for the students to have their work recognised.
“Our belief is the arts really support student learning, encourage creativity, abstract thinking, support literacy and numeracy and the students absolutely love it,” he said.
“They actually learn skills with art, so they build on the skills year after year. Whether they become professional artists or not, they will have a hobby they enjoy for the rest of their lives.”
